Computer

 Engineering




Computer engineering is a vast field that includes engineers who write application software, low level software that controls computer hardware, and design computer hardware. Computer engineers delve deeper into the electronic workings of the computer hardware and devices. They design computer interfaces, hardware, and controlling devices for computer components New fields of computer engineering are robotics and virtual reality systems. Advances such as Java and the internet will create a huge demand for these engineers as more businessess will make computers an essential part of their business and will need software and hardware. This field is changing so rapidly that the need increases yearly for more computer and software engineers either willing to work directly with hardware or with software development experience.

A degree in computer engineering can either be software engineering related or hardware design related. The hardware design degrees are usually out of the electrical engineering colleges while the software engineering degrees are in the computer science college although this may vary from school to school. In college, students will study:

  • software engineering concepts
  • computer graphics
  • computer system design
  • robotics
  • computer networking
  • databases
